Dondi
18.12.2016, 02:20
Помогите пожалуйста! Как найти проблему ? Это часто под вечер случается, садишься в свое авто или фракционное и появляется диалог
if(caridi >= ArendaCar[0] && caridi <= ArendaCar[1] && ArendaCarPlayer[caridi] == -1) ShowPlayerDialog(playerid, 248, DIALOG_STYLE_MSGBOX, "{0089FF}Аренда самолета", "Стоимость аренды: 80.000", "Арендовать", "Закрыть");
case 248:
{
if(response)
{
if(pTemp[playerid][pArendaCar] != -1)
{
SetVehicleToRespawn(pTemp[playerid][pArendaCar]);
ArendaCarPlayer[pTemp[playerid][pArendaCar]] = -1;
pTemp[playerid][pArendaCar] = -1;
pTemp[playerid][pArendaTime] = -1;
}
new caridi = GetPlayerVehicleID(playerid);
pTemp[playerid][pArendaCar] = caridi;
pTemp[playerid][pArendaTime] = 600;
ArendaCarPlayer[caridi] = playerid;
SendClientMessage(playerid, 0x66CC00AA, "Вы арендовали самолет, внимание если вы оставите самолет без внимания более чем на 10 минут");
SendClientMessage(playerid, 0x66CC00AA, "Он будет отбуксирован назад в аэропорт.");
PlayerInfo[playerid][pCash] -= 80000;
}
else RemoveFromVehicle(playerid);
return 1;
}
if(caridi >= ArendaCar[0] && caridi <= ArendaCar[1] && ArendaCarPlayer[caridi] == -1) ShowPlayerDialog(playerid, 248, DIALOG_STYLE_MSGBOX, "{0089FF}Аренда самолета", "Стоимость аренды: 80.000", "Арендовать", "Закрыть");
case 248:
{
if(response)
{
if(pTemp[playerid][pArendaCar] != -1)
{
SetVehicleToRespawn(pTemp[playerid][pArendaCar]);
ArendaCarPlayer[pTemp[playerid][pArendaCar]] = -1;
pTemp[playerid][pArendaCar] = -1;
pTemp[playerid][pArendaTime] = -1;
}
new caridi = GetPlayerVehicleID(playerid);
pTemp[playerid][pArendaCar] = caridi;
pTemp[playerid][pArendaTime] = 600;
ArendaCarPlayer[caridi] = playerid;
SendClientMessage(playerid, 0x66CC00AA, "Вы арендовали самолет, внимание если вы оставите самолет без внимания более чем на 10 минут");
SendClientMessage(playerid, 0x66CC00AA, "Он будет отбуксирован назад в аэропорт.");
PlayerInfo[playerid][pCash] -= 80000;
}
else RemoveFromVehicle(playerid);
return 1;
}